Condividi tramite


CDaoRecordset::CDaoRecordset

 

Pubblicato: aprile 2016

Costruisce un oggetto CDaoRecordset.

Sintassi

      CDaoRecordset(
   CDaoDatabase* pDatabase = NULL 
);

Parametri

  • pDatabase
    Contiene un puntatore a un oggetto CDaoDatabase o al valore NULL. Se non NULL e la funzione membro Apri dell'oggetto CDaoDatabase non è stato chiamato per connetterlo all'origine dati, i tentativi di recordset per aprirla automaticamente durante una chiamata Apri. Se si passa NULL, un oggetto CDaoDatabase viene costruito e connesso automaticamente utilizzando le informazioni di origine dati specificato se derivaste la classe recordset da CDaoRecordset.

Note

È possibile utilizzare direttamente CDaoRecordset o derivare una classe specifica dell'applicazione da CDaoRecordset. È possibile utilizzare ClassWizard per derivare le classi recordset.

Nota

Se si deriva una classe CDaoRecordset, la classe derivata deve fornire il proprio costruttore.Nel costruttore della classe derivata, chiamare il costruttore CDaoRecordset::CDaoRecordset, passando parametri appropriati in avanti.

Passare NULL al costruttore del recordset per disporre di un oggetto CDaoDatabase costruito e connesso automaticamente. Si tratta di un collegamento utile che non richiede di costruire e connettere un oggetto CDaoDatabase prima della costruzione del recordset. Se l'oggetto CDaoDatabase non è aperto, un oggetto CDaoWorkspace verrà creato automaticamente da utilizzare l'area di lavoro predefinita. Per ulteriori informazioni, vedere CDaoDatabase::CDaoDatabase.

Requisiti

Header: afxdao.h

Vedere anche

CDaoRecordset Class
Grafico delle gerarchie
CDaoRecordset::GetDefaultDBName
CDaoRecordset::GetDefaultSQL
CDaoRecordset::GetDateCreated
CDaoRecordset::GetDateLastUpdated